Former Opposition leader, Hon Mathias Mpuuga, has welcomed singer Alien Skin into his new political party. The Nyendo-Mukungwe MP introduced a new pressure group at Malibu Gardens in Namirembe. This pressure group, named The Democratic Alliance, is expected to gradually transition into a political party, according to the MP.
Among those present at the party launch was singer Alien Skin. The two even went on to sign a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U), though the specifics of their agreement are not disclosed.

While speaking to the audience, Alien Skin mentioned that he and Mpuuga share many similarities. He revealed that one of the reasons he ended up in Luzira Prison was for stealing a phone. Conversely, Mpuuga was also accused of taking Shs 500 million. Thus, they deserve to associate with each other since they are kindred spirits.

“Ladies and gentlemen, I want to share that one of the reasons for my arrest was allegedly stealing a phone. Not everyone imprisoned in Luzira is guilty, and not everyone outside is innocent. There are also claims that Hon Mpuuga stole Shs 500 million, so we are both seen as thieves. As the saying goes, birds of the same feather flock together,” stated the Sitya Danger artist.

It’s important to note that Mpuuga had a falling out with Bobi Wine’s NUP a few months ago after accusations arose regarding an ethically questionable service commission he allegedly retained. As a result, he was removed from his role as Leader of Opposition and succeeded by Hon Joel Ssenyonyi. Additionally, Mpuuga lost his position as deputy president of NUP in the Buganda region.
